A recap on differences between brisket raw and foie gras
- Brisket raw has more zinc and vitamin B6; however, foie gras is higher in vitamin B12, vitamin A, selenium, iron, and copper.
- Foie gras covers your daily vitamin B12 needs 290% more than brisket raw.
- Foie gras contains 7 times less vitamin B6 than brisket raw. Brisket raw contains 0.42mg of vitamin B6, while foie gras contains 0.06mg.
- Brisket raw has less cholesterol.
Food varieties used in this article are Beef, brisket, whole, separable lean only, all grades, raw and Pate de foie gras, canned (goose liver pate), smoked.
